Originally created as a tool for professionals, divers' watches have now become a staple of the sports watch genre. Boasting exceptional water resistance and excellent legibility, coupled with the romantic notion of being over-specified for everyday use, divers' watches have gained popularity among a wide range of age groups.
Due to its origins as a tool watch, its design was once dominated by a stoic style that emphasized functionality. However, in recent years, the variations have become increasingly diverse, with vibrant colors, dressy designs using precious metals and jewels, and even smaller sizes that are easy for women to wear. Modern diver's watches combine durability and design, making them convenient fashion items suitable not only for professional use but also for everyday wear.

Blancpain "Fifty Fathoms Automatic" Ref. 5007 12B44R NAFA
Blancpain is a watch brand with a long history, founded in 1735. Its signature collection, the Fifty Fathoms, was launched in 1953 and is said to have laid the foundation for the modern diver's watch. Today, it is developed as a diver's watch that combines performance and elegance for professional use.

Movement (Cal. 1153). 28 jewels. 21,600 vph. Power reserve approximately 100 hours. Ti case (diameter 38.2 mm, thickness 12 mm). Water resistant to 300 m. 2,574,000 yen (tax included). (Inquiries) Blancpain Boutique Ginza Tel. 03-6254-7233
The Ref. 5007 12B44R NAFA is a model unified in a feminine pink color scheme. The dial is made of mother-of-pearl with a petal pink gradient color, and the indexes and hands are even brighter pink. It is also paired with a petal pink bezel and a NATO strap with stripes of the same color, creating a lovely, unified look.
The 38.2mm case is made of lightweight, scratch-resistant titanium, making it comfortable to wear for long periods of time. It also boasts 300m water resistance and a unidirectional rotating bezel with a sapphire crystal insert. While it's the smallest watch in the collection, it's a no-compromise design for a serious diver's watch.
The movement is Cal. 1153, which not only boasts a long power reserve of approximately 100 hours, but also achieves the high level of magnetic resistance required for everyday use thanks to the use of a silicon balance spring.
Breitling Superocean Heritage Automatic 36, Ref. A10390361L1S1
Breitling has deep ties to the world of aviation and is known as one of the pioneers of chronograph watches. With a wide range of high-performance watches, the brand is suited to all situations, whether on land, sea, or air. Of these, the brand has selected the Superocean Heritage, which dominates the seas.

Automatic winding (Cal. 10). 28,800 vibrations per hour. Power reserve approximately 42 hours. Stainless steel case (diameter 36 mm). 200 m water resistant. 770,000 yen (tax included). (Inquiries) Breitling Japan Tel. 0120-105-707
The Ref. A10390361L1S1 features a compact 36mm diameter and a turquoise-green color. The dial features a sunray pattern radiating from the center, creating a unique look while highlighting the distinctive hour and minute hands and wedge-shaped indexes. The case also features a unidirectional rotating bezel with a matching ceramic bezel insert and a mesh-like rubber strap, creating a refreshing look that's perfect for the beach.
The stainless steel case is just 10.42mm thick, making it relatively slim for a mechanical diver's watch. The movement is the Breitling Caliber 10, which has a power reserve of approximately 42 hours.
The watch's distinctive hour and minute hands and bezel, with a texture reminiscent of anodized aluminum, were inspired by the brand's first diver's watch, released in 1957. While exuding a vintage feel, this watch is a perfect combination of the authentic specifications of a diver's watch and a fashionable design that suits casual occasions.
TAG Heuer "TAG Heuer Aquaracer Professional 200 Solargraph" Ref. WBP1313.BA0005
TAG Heuer is a brand that has made a name for itself, particularly in the field of sports timing, since its founding in 1860. One of its signature models, the TAG Heuer Aquaracer, has gained popularity as a diver's watch with a smart appearance that is easy to wear in everyday life.

Solar movement (Cal. TH50-00). Stainless steel case (34mm diameter). 200m water resistant. 434,500 yen (tax included). (Inquiries) LVMH Watch & Jewelry Japan TAG Heuer Tel. 03-5635-7054
Among the many variations, this time we have picked out the Ref. WBP1313.BA0005 from the "Tag Heuer Aquaracer Professional 200 Solargraph" series. Combining a robust case water resistant to 200m with a solar quartz movement and a mother-of-pearl dial, this watch combines beauty with practicality.
This model features 11 diamonds as indexes, giving it a particularly elegant impression. At the same time, it also retains the iconic design that symbolizes the collection, such as the 12-sided bezel with six rider tabs and the large crown, achieving a sporty yet elegant appearance.
The stainless steel case measures 34mm in diameter, giving it a subtle presence that makes it suitable for both business and personal use. Furthermore, the solar-powered quartz movement eliminates the need for periodic battery changes compared to primary batteries, making it a desirable choice for busy businesspeople.
Oris Aquis Date Taste of Summer Ref. 01 733 7792 4158-07 8 19 05P
Founded in 1904, Oris is an independent brand that offers high-quality Swiss-made mechanical watches at excellent value prices. Among its watches, the Aquis Date diver's watch is a staple collection with its timeless design and robust construction.

Automatic winding (Cal. Oris 733). 26 jewels. 28,800 vph. Power reserve approximately 41 hours. Stainless steel case (diameter 36.5 mm, thickness 11.95 mm). 300m water resistant. 407,000 yen (tax included). (Inquiries) Oris Japan Tel. 03-6260-6876
From the Aquis Date collection, we have selected a summer-themed model with a 36.5mm diameter case. This eye-catching color scheme is called "Sunrise Red Pink," and its gradational coloring evokes the image of a summer sunrise. Furthermore, the hour and minute hands reach the edge of the dial, along with the shield-shaped hour markers, ensure excellent visibility.
Additionally, various details of this model that underwent a 2024 update are also noteworthy. While maintaining its 300m water resistance, the case silhouette, lugs, and crown guard have been redesigned to create a more refined appearance. Furthermore, the bracelet has been changed from the previous model to a tapered design with wider center links, and a new quick-adjust system has been added that allows for fine-tuning of the bracelet length without tools, improving the fit.
The movement is Cal. Oris 733. The power reserve is approximately 41 hours.
Tudor Black Bay 54 "Lagoon Blue" Ref. M79000-0001
Tudor is a brand with a history dating back to its founding as a diffusion brand of Rolex. Today, it has established its own development and manufacturing system and offers a diverse collection that combines vintage watch design with modern specifications.

Automatic (Cal. MT5400). 27 jewels. Power reserve approximately 70 hours. Stainless steel case (37mm diameter). Water resistant to 200m. 619,300 yen (tax included). (Inquiries) Rolex Japan / Tudor Tel. 0120-929-570
The Black Bay 54 is a collection that inherits the design codes of the brand's first diver's watch, the Oyster Prince Submariner Ref. 7922, which was released in 1954. The Ref. M79000-0001, which belongs to this collection, is a popular model known as "Lagoon Blue."
The most distinctive feature of this model is the pale turquoise dial, reminiscent of the tropical sea. The surface is sand-textured, giving it the appearance of a water surface, and the contrast with the texture of the hands and indexes enhances legibility. The bezel also features a mirror-polished stainless steel insert, adding a dressy touch to the watch.
The small 37mm case without crown guards and the iconic snowflake hands are reminiscent of the original model from the 1950s. The five-row link bracelet is fitted with a unique "T-fit" quick-adjust clasp, which allows for adjustment of the length by approximately 8mm in five steps.
Inside is the Caliber MT5400, certified by the Swiss Chronometer Testing Institute. It boasts a highly reliable and practical movement, including an anti-magnetic silicon balance spring and a power reserve of approximately 70 hours.
